I removed a bulging Koshin 1000uf 10V cap and also a "Saturn" brand 1000uf 10V cap from a DEER PSU.
The Koshin cap had a grey coloured sleeving and was 10mm in diaemter, the Saturn cap was had a balck sleeve and was 8mm in diameter. The Saturn cap was on the +5V SB and the 10V Koshin was on the 5V line I think?? The motherboard it was powering had a burnt southbridge. Is this the 'Saturn' brand cap you're talking about?
http://www.badcaps.net/forum/attachm...achmentid=4387 I don't believe we ever positively identified these caps, but most people believe they are rebranded Lelon caps. They sure vent like Lelons :pimp: |
Re: The Hall of Shame - Badcaps Photo Montage
Yup - that's the one I call 'Saturn'. It's pretty ubiquitous, especially in Deer/L&C PSUs, and it's got higher failure rates than Fuhjyyu/CapXon, about the same as Jun Fu, and probably a tad better than YEC/Chhsi/GSC.
